Update module source code, documentation and tests to support Hapi 17. .
The main change introduced is the usage of async/await, although some updates were also made in order to comply with new linter rules introduced by lab.
All core modules were updated to their latests version
Support was removed for Node 4 and 6. Node 8 and 9 were added to the test matrix.
All examples are now runnable
Issues
Joi validations were moved from .validate to .assert. That changed how the error is formatted. Right now that specific test is commented. Should I update the test to match the new formatting or keep validate and throw the returned error?
Is there something else I am missing with this update?
Your help reviewing this would be pretty much appreciated.
This thread has been automatically locked due to inactivity. Please open a new issue for related bugs or questions following the new issue template instructions.
Update module source code, documentation and tests to support Hapi 17. .
Issues
.validate
to.assert
. That changed how the error is formatted. Right now that specific test is commented. Should I update the test to match the new formatting or keepvalidate
and throw the returned error?Your help reviewing this would be pretty much appreciated.
Solves #105 #98 #100 #97 Relates to #104